About

Paradox Lake Campground is a New York State DEC facility situated on rolling hills of hardwood forest along the shore of Dark Bay, which opens onto the 4.75-mile-long Paradox Lake in the Adirondacks. The campground offers 58 campsites with modern amenities including hot showers and flush toilets, making it an ideal base camp for exploring the region. The lake provides excellent opportunities for boating and fishing, with motor boats allowed via a single-lane natural sand and gravel launch ramp. Canoes, rowboats, kayaks, and standup paddleboards are available for rent at the registration booth. Anglers can target smallmouth bass, yellow perch, and northern pike in the abundant waters. The day use area features a picnic area with pavilion rental and wheelchair accessible restrooms. Hikers will appreciate the proximity to the Pharaoh Lake Wilderness Area, with trails leaving from near the campground entrance providing access to Crane, Oxshoe, Crab, Putnam, and Horseshoe Ponds, as well as Pharaoh Lake and Pharaoh Mountain. The summit of Pharaoh Mountain offers comprehensive views that reward the climb. Additional trails to Peaked Hill and Peaked Hill Pond are accessible by boat from the opposite shore. The campground also features a Junior Naturalist Program for children ages 5-13. First developed in 1931 with 32 sites, the campground expanded to its current 58-site configuration in 1968.

Directions

From I-87, take Exit 28, then Route 74 east approximately 4 miles to Paradox Lake. Campground is located at 897 NYS Route 74, Paradox, NY.
